On Nov 22, 2004, at 7:56 PM, Bill Kearney wrote:

> Why not make better use of RDF and more closely model it after the way 
> a 2.0
> element appears?
>
> <enc:enclosure rdf:resource="http://some/external/file.mp3" />
>
> Or merely use:
>
> <rdfs:seeAlso rdf:resource="http://some/external/file.mp3" />
>
> And then use a subseqent rdf:Description to 'say more' about it:
>
> <rdf:Description rdf:about="http://some/external/file.mp3" />
>     <dc:title>Some music file</dc:title>
>     <dc... insert various and sundry dublin core elements.... />
>
>     <enc:length>1939570</enc:length>
>     <enc:type>audio/mpeg</enc:type>
>
>     ...as well as anything else...
> </rdf:Description>

> Perhaps some sort of "this is intended to be treated as an enclosure" 
> markup
> would also help.
